Section 1: Understanding GitHub Accounts
Features and Structure of GitHub Accounts
A GitHub account is a digital profile that allows users to participate in software development, project collaboration, and technology learning. It provides access to features such as repositories, profiles, project discussions, documentation tools, and collaboration features.
Understanding these features helps users learn how modern software projects are organised. A repository, for example, provides a structured space where files, documentation, and project history can be managed.
GitHub accounts also introduce users to important development concepts such as version control and collaborative workflows. These ideas help people understand how teams create, review, and improve digital projects.
From an educational perspective, learning how GitHub works develops problem-solving abilities and technical confidence. Users can explore projects, practise skills, and learn from shared knowledge.
